Waterloo Regional Police Investigating Serious Collision in Kitchener

Posted on: Saturday May 9
Location: Kitchener
Occurrence #: WA26067145

Waterloo Regional Police are investigating a serious collision involving a motorcycle and a motor vehicle in Kitchener.

On May 9, 2026, at approximately 1:15 a.m., emergency services responded to reports of a collision involving a Buick motor vehicle and a Honda motorcycle at Victoria Street South and Walnut Street. 

The motorcycle driver, a 25-year-old Kitchener male, was transported to an out-of-region hospital with serious but non-life-threatening injuries. The driver of Buick was not injured.

The intersection was closed for several hours while members of WRPS’ Traffic Services Unit investigated the collision.

The investigation remains ongoing, and charges are anticipated.
